Senate Roll Call 1099, 95th Congress · October 9, 1978

TO TABLE THE CHURCH AMENDMENT TO H.R. 13511, AN AMENDMENT THAT WOULD GRADUALLY REPEAL THE CURRENT LAW THAT ALLOWS U.S. CORPORATIONS TO DEFER THEIR TAXES PAYABLE ON FOREIGN EARNINGS UNTIL SUCH TIME THAT THEIR PROFITS ARE REPATRIATED.

61 yea · 17 nay18 not voting or present
Democrat33 yea · 17 nay
Republican31 yea · 0 nay
Independent1 yea · 0 nay
